Just picked up the latest issue of Billboard Magazine, here are the official writing credits for both...
Crack A Bottle Eminem, Dr. Dre & 50 Cent
Dr. Dre ( M. Mathers, C.J. Jackson Jr., A. Young, D. Parker, M. Batson, E. Coomes, T. Lawrence, J. Renard )
Shady\Aftermath\Interscope
I Get It In 50 Cent
Dr. Dre, M. Batson ( C.J. Jackson Jr., A. Young, M. Batson, D. Parker, T. Lawrence )
Shady\Aftermath\Interscope
* Now we know "I Get It In" is co-produced by Mark Batson and one of Dre's new or recent musicians is Eric Coomes, known for playing guitar and bass on a grip of DJ Quik songs. According to the publishing notes, "J. Renard" is the French composer that Dre sampled on "Crack A Bottle". Says here 'Amplitude Publishing France". More than likely, T. Lawrence is a new keyboard player, as he is listed on both tracks.
